If f(x) = 4x – 2 and g(x) = 5x – 3, what is g(f(2))?
barxatty [35]

Step-by-step explanation:

f(2) = 4(2) - 2

= 8 - 2

= 6

g(f(2)) = g(6)

g(6) = 5(6) - 3

= 30 - 3

= 27

g(f(2)) = 27
